数据库检索式的定义及应用解析
在数据库中,检索式指的是用于查询数据的一种语法或表达式。它用于指定所需数据的条件和约束,以便从数据库中检索出符合条件的数据。检索式通常是在查询语句中使用的一部分,用于过滤和排序数据。
以下是关于数据库中检索式的一些重要概念和意义:
-
条件筛选:检索式允许使用条件来筛选数据。通过在检索式中指定条件,可以选择满足特定要求的数据行。例如,可以使用检索式筛选出所有销售额大于1000的订单。
-
逻辑运算符:检索式可以使用逻辑运算符(例如AND、OR、NOT)来组合多个条件。这使得可以根据多个条件来检索数据。例如,可以使用检索式同时筛选出销售额大于1000且客户为VIP的订单。
-
排序:检索式还可以指定数据的排序方式。可以根据一个或多个列对检索的结果进行升序或降序排列。例如,可以使用检索式按照销售额降序排列订单。
-
聚合函数:检索式可以使用聚合函数对数据进行计算和汇总。聚合函数可以用于计算总和、平均值、最大值、最小值等。例如,可以使用检索式计算出某个产品的销售总额。
-
数据范围:检索式可以指定要检索的数据的范围。可以通过指定条件来限制检索的行数或列数。例如,可以使用检索式只检索最近一个月的销售数据。
总结起来,检索式在数据库中起着非常重要的作用,它允许用户根据特定的条件和要求从数据库中检索所需的数据。通过灵活运用检索式,可以实现高效的数据查询和分析。
数据库中的检索式是用来描述用户对数据库中数据进行查询的一种语言或表达方式。它是按照一定的规则和语法编写的字符串,用于描述用户希望从数据库中检索出哪些数据。
检索式通常由关键字、操作符、操作数和逻辑运算符组成。关键字用于指定要检索的字段或表,操作符用于指定检索条件,操作数用于提供具体的数值或字符串,逻辑运算符用于连接多个检索条件。
在数据库中,常见的检索式语言包括结构化查询语言(SQL)以及各种专用的查询语言(如LDAP查询语言等)。通过编写检索式,用户可以指定需要检索的数据范围、过滤条件、排序方式等,从而实现对数据库中数据的灵活查询和检索。
例如,一个简单的检索式可以是:SELECT * FROM 表名 WHERE 字段名 = '检索条件',其中SELECT关键字指定检索的字段,FROM关键字指定检索的表,WHERE关键字指定检索的条件,'检索条件'为具体的数值或字符串。
通过编写合理的检索式,用户可以根据自己的需求从数据库中快速、准确地检索出所需的数据,提高数据的利用价值和查询效率。
在数据库中,检索式(Query)是指用于从数据库中获取特定数据的请求或命令。它是一种结构化的语句,通常包含了关键字、条件、操作符和函数等元素,用于指定所需的数据集合或数据筛选条件。
检索式的目的是根据特定的查询需求,从数据库中提取出符合条件的数据记录。通过使用检索式,可以根据指定的条件过滤数据、排序数据、汇总数据、计算数据等。
下面是一些常见的数据库查询语句和操作:
-
SELECT语句:用于从数据库中选择(检索)数据记录。可以指定要检索的列、要检索的表、要检索的条件等。例如:
SELECT * FROM 表名 WHERE 条件;
-
WHERE子句:用于指定查询条件,根据条件过滤出符合条件的数据记录。可以使用操作符(比较、逻辑等)和函数来构建条件。例如:
SELECT * FROM 表名 WHERE 列名 = 值;
-
ORDER BY子句:用于指定结果集的排序顺序。可以按照一个或多个列进行升序或降序排序。例如:
SELECT * FROM 表名 ORDER BY 列名 ASC/DESC;
-
GROUP BY子句:用于按照一个或多个列对结果集进行分组。通常与聚合函数一起使用,对每个组进行汇总计算。例如:
SELECT 列名, COUNT(*) FROM 表名 GROUP BY 列名;
-
JOIN操作:用于将两个或多个表连接在一起,根据关联的列将它们的数据合并在一起。例如:
SELECT * FROM 表1 JOIN 表2 ON 表1.列名 = 表2.列名;
以上仅是一些常见的数据库查询语句和操作,实际上,数据库查询语句非常灵活,可以根据具体需求进行组合和扩展。在编写检索式时,需要根据具体的数据库系统和语法规则进行操作。